Waste-to-Energy Technologies



With waste generation on the rise, discovering sustainable remedies is becoming significantly crucial. Waste-to-Energy (WtE) modern technologies provide an appealing approach to handling our waste while generating power. These innovations involve converting non-recyclable waste products into functional types of power like power, warm, or fuel.



By diverting waste from landfills and incinerating it in controlled settings, WtE not only decreases the quantity of waste yet additionally creates beneficial energy resources.

One typical method of WtE is mass-burn incineration, where waste is burned at heats to create steam that drives turbines producing electricity. One more approach is gasification, which converts waste into synthetic gas that can be utilized for power generation or as a chemical feedstock.

In addition, anaerobic digestion breaks down organic waste to generate biogas for power.

Implementing WtE technologies can help reduce greenhouse gas exhausts, lower reliance on fossil fuels, and lessen the ecological effect of garbage disposal. As we strive for an extra lasting future, embracing Waste-to-Energy innovations can play an essential function in addressing our growing waste administration difficulties.
